Frugal setup - your comments please

quadiator

Blitz 3rd Class
Original poster
22
6
I was considering this super frugal setup

Hardware:
F1 micro - google free tier

Software:
Emby
mrmachine/python-googledrive-videostream

Content:
Gdrive account - content sourced by a 3rd party


How does it work?
  • 'mrmachine/python-googledrive-videostream' scans every 5 minutes for any new content added to GDrive. Generate STRM files for new content
  • Emby libraries pointed to folders with STRM files, downloads metadata etc
  • Emby client is served content directly from Gdrive

Questions/discussion points:
  1. I noticed 10gb 1080 files are being served at a lower bit rate by gdrive. Guess gdrive scales the 1080p down to 15mbps no matter how high the bit rate is. This is not a big issue for me, but is it a big issue for you? Why is this a big deal?
  2. f1 micro has 30 gb disk. That should be plenty for metadata i was thinking? Is there a way to point metadata back to gdrive too?
  3. Why isnt plex supporting STRM? What do they have to loose? Based on my quick search, it sounds like they have dropped support for STRM recently.
  4. Would plexguide team have any plans to productise this frugal setup? I was told recent version of emby has some issues. Trying to get reverse proxy to do some shady denial on port as a workaround (ddurdle has sent me a script that i am in the process of integrating)
 

quadiator

Blitz 3rd Class
Original poster
22
6
@ddurdle has been helping with trying to get this going (with a emby bug that is forcing some streams be brokered via emby instead of direct play). Perhaps he may know how to productise this on plexguide setup?
 

quadiator

Blitz 3rd Class
Original poster
22
6
Yah i have an instance of that running. All the clients seem to be out of support - app on tv etc.
They are looking for volunteers at the moment to support all the apps by the looks of it.
 
Assists Greatly with Development Costs

quadiator

Blitz 3rd Class
Original poster
22
6
well - i am a novice. applying a very basic logic of the setup - relying on gdrive to serve up the video, when encrypted it is just a data blob.

Why did you bother encrypting your media? i can understand the obvious reasons. Does plexguide let you serve encrypted media - decryption on the fly? I assume for encrypted media, it will have to wait for the whole file to download to your box before it could decry-pt and serve?
 

quadiator

Blitz 3rd Class
Original poster
22
6
i have been using google shell. All traffic within google domain is free. I dont know how CPU intensive is encrypting - you sure could use google resources to move data around. Shell has a booster option available as well.! give it a shot
 

timetrex

Blitz Sergeant
Staff
105
19
I use the gdrive add on with Kodi. I know it direct plays from gdrive. Bit rate doesn't change. Alot of my content would be remuxes.

Havent bothered with this add on. Find myself now just using powershell and generating the strm instead of exporting with the addon. The export takes longer. My powershell script done in a few seconds.

Since it's just me using my library, kodi is fine. I may explore other routes if i add users /family but for now Kodi will do.
 

medstudent12

Blitz Noob
1
0
this is exactly what I want

can you please create a tutorial or help me if you can
I often get cant play file from emby and I have issues with transcoding
 

timetrex

Blitz Sergeant
Staff
105
19
ok, ill copy it later. The powershell script relies on current official gdrive plugin in for kodi.
The reasoning is when access is granted to your gdrive.. It created unique. shrer path to folder / file path on gdrive. Once you know the path, you can simply script it and run it when you like. you could use ddurdle version as well. It doesnt matter. Just discovering the fie path, which you can see when you run any of their exports from kodi / emby
 

timetrex

Blitz Sergeant
Staff
105
19
Attached is basic script, You do need google file stream installed.
Also need to first create an strm file using kodi plugin either from ddurdle or official one.

Apart from that, powershell creates the files in a matter of seconds. Allot quicker.
Csv file contains all your movies, you can manually create for one file if need be,

I have the script exporting to a shared folder which my kodi install on the shield reads from.

You may get issues creating files with special characters, I havent taken that into account Since raddarr and sonnar name my files .

rename to ps1 file
 

Attachments

Create an account or login to comment

You must be a member in order to leave a comment

Create account

Create an account on our community. It's easy!

Log in

Already have an account? Log in here.

Similar threads


Development Donations

 

Trending